Line
A line graph draws connecting lines between data points. They are often used for highlighting trends in data over intervals of time.
-
Bar
Bar graphs have rectangular bars. The length of the bars correspond to the values they represent. Bar graphs are appropriate for plotting data that is continuous (e.g., weight, height) or discontinuous (e.g., eye color, shoe size).
The bars can be plotted horizontally or vertically.
-
Pie
Pie charts are divided into sections that illustrate proportion. The area of each section is proportional to the quantity it represents. You can enter percentages (e.g., 20 and 80) or just enter your raw counts (e.g., 376, 471 and 809) and let Capital Charts do the math for you.
